A little less than a year ago Isaac shared the story of how his brother Justin and his wife Adrienne moved a neighbor’s old barn through the fields about a mile away to rest in a field next to their house. That blog post with videos can be found here. They plan to restore it and turn it into an airbnb vacation getaway. They had moved another old barn in a similar fashion in 2011, about 3/4 of a mile through a field and over dry run creek, and spent the next decade restoring it and turning it into an airbnb. You can view the airbnb listing here. While Williamsport, Ohio has never been a hot spot for vacationers, many people from out of town love the peaceful scenery and pastoral landscape. There is a herd of friendly belted galloway cattle in the neighboring pasture, a hot tub and swimming pool, and spacious rooms to gather with family and friends.

Here we are, less than a year later, and they’ve managed to move yet another, bigger barn 3.3 miles down the road, across fields and 3 different roads. They will begin restoring it to give it a new life, potentially as a location for small weddings or family gatherings.
